Leroy W. "Lee" Bechtel

March 4, 1940 — September 3, 2021

Leroy W. “Lee” Bechtel, 81, of Manheim, died peacefully on Friday, September 3, 2021 at the Lancaster General Hospital. Born in Annville, he was the son of the late Lewis and Emily Immel Bechtel. He was the loving companion of Alma J. Miller for many years. Leroy worked for a textile company in Central Pennsylvania. A proud veteran, he served in the U.S. Army during the Vietnam War. Leroy had a deep passion for the outdoors; and enjoyed riding his motorcycle, hunting, fishing, clay target shooting, and camping. He was a member of the Elstonville Sportsmen’s Association, Dela-Ches Fishing Association, and the Palmyra Sportsmen’s Association.

Surviving in addition to his companion, Alma Miller; is a daughter, Bonnie M. Miller of Gerrardstown, WV, three sons: David L. husband of Audrey Miller of Manheim, twins, Frank W. husband of Candy Miller of Pine Grove, Bill S. husband of Sara Miller of Bainbridge, four grandchildren, three great grandchildren, a brother, Sterl husband of Diane Bechtel of Palmyra, two sisters: Pearl Frantz, and Edith wife of Harry Gordon all of Palmyra, and four nieces, and three nephews. Preceding him in death are four brothers: Norman, Bob, Lewis Jr. and Jim Bechtel.
